Definition:


  1. Cannabis: A genus of flowering plants in the family Cannabaceae, often used for its psychoactive and medicinal properties.
  2. Strain: A specific variety or genetic subtype of a plant, often bred for particular characteristics such as flavor, potency, or effects.
  3. Pinnacle: The highest point or peak; in this context, it likely refers to a top-quality or premium version of a cannabis strain.
  4. THCa (Tetrahydrocannabinolic Acid): A non-psychoactive cannabinoid found in raw and live cannabis which converts into THC (the main psychoactive component) when heated through processes like smoking or vaping.
